logo

Output c1598321f48f4b1c5a0b874dbcb126445938db5d64be94a4f36a20408e1f59e9:1

value
29015693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ab57e835d112306405e5ad6fce45a6a5c3a24c4 OP_EQUALVERIFY OP_CHECKSIG
address
16MRcZhGzzC31XHeApjeqpUSWpxP2YRcPq
transaction
c1598321f48f4b1c5a0b874dbcb126445938db5d64be94a4f36a20408e1f59e9